Saint-Louis

Thiébou DièyeA rich, aromatic fish stew simmered in a tomato-based broth with onions, cumin, coriander, and fiery chili peppers. The Saint-Louis version often features fresh tilapia or catfish caught locally, served with fluffy white rice and a side of crisp fried plantains. The texture is hearty, with tender fish melting into the robust, slightly spicy sauce.
Yassa PouletA tangy chicken dish marinated in soy sauce, lemon juice, and onions, then slow-cooked to perfection. In Saint-Louis, it's often served with a side of rice and a sprinkle of fresh parsley. The meat is tender and juicy, with a deep, savory flavor that highlights the local ingredients sourced from regional markets.
DoudiaA hearty stew made with beef or fish, tomatoes, onions, and a medley of vegetables like potatoes, carrots, and cabbage. The Saint-Louis version is spiced with local chili peppers and garlic, creating a bold, satisfying dish served with crusty bread. The texture is thick and comforting, perfect for sharing with family.

Nagercoil

Nagercoil BiryaniA fragrant and flavorful biryani that is a staple in Nagercoil. Made with locally sourced basmati rice, succulent chicken, and a complex blend of spices including cardamom, cloves, and bay leaves. The rice is slow-cooked with meat in layers to ensure each grain absorbs the rich flavors. Traditionally served with a side of curd or salad.
PalappamA traditional Kerala dish that is a must-try in Nagercoil. Made from fermented rice batter, this pancake-like dish has a soft, spongy texture and a mildly sweet flavor. Served with coconut chutney or spicy fish curry, it offers a unique balance of flavors and textures.
Neer Moong DalA light and refreshing dal made from moong lentils, popular in Nagercoil due to its cooling properties. Cooked with local herbs and spices like cumin and coriander, it has a smooth consistency and is often served with steamed rice or roti. Perfect for beating the tropical heat.
